A truly great library is more than just a collection of books—it’s a gateway to history, a sanctuary of ideas, and a masterpiece of design. Some university libraries around the world feel as though they’ve been pulled straight from the pages of a fantasy novel, with towering bookshelves, intricate woodwork, celestial domes, and hidden passageways that whisper secrets of the past. From the awe-inspiring halls of ancient institutions to ultra-modern libraries pushing the boundaries of architecture, these spaces are not just for students—they’re living, breathing testaments to the power of knowledge. Each library on this expanded list of 24 breathtaking destinations offers a unique blend of architectural splendor, historical significance, and academic prestige, making them must-visit locations for scholars, book lovers, and travelers alike. Whether you're exploring ornate baroque libraries filled with centuries-old manuscripts, wandering through sleek, futuristic buildings designed for the digital age, or standing beneath the grandeur of vaulted ceilings lined with endless rows of books, these libraries remind us that the pursuit of knowledge is, at its core, a beautiful and transformative experience.
